Output efe9559a912fa7694372c7c603086e629c2103bfe0ab541fb581a316efef9624:0

value
6592625
script pubkey
OP_0 OP_PUSHBYTES_20 044320ff36f8990495c588abab5594a1ab6184f6
address
bc1qq3pjpleklzvsf9w93z46k4v55x4krp8kuwqk5s
transaction
efe9559a912fa7694372c7c603086e629c2103bfe0ab541fb581a316efef9624